输入一个视频页面网址能返回flv的真实地址.  
示例:http://v.youku.com/v_show/id_XNzgyOTU1MDg=.html真实地址: 
http://f.youku.com/player/getFlvPath/sid/00_00/st/flv/fileid/020064020049BE29B13D2A009DC29857CFCD8F-72A4-6B6C-CCEB-F60A57072894?K=2b42dc8a2348e9601824b5b5
http://f.youku.com/player/getFlvPath/sid/00_00/st/flv/fileid/020064020149BE29B13D2A009DC29857CFCD8F-72A4-6B6C-CCEB-F60A57072894?K=2b42dc8a2348e9601824b5b5求在线分析FLV真实地址的核心代码,谢谢了.

解决方案 »

  1.   

    function vedios($key){ // $key就是:XNzgyOTU1MDg= 一段
    //用最简易的办法来获取YOUku的源地址;
    $time = time();
    //不可修改
    $auth = md5(time().' XOA== MWZlNWE4Y2Q4OWQ0NjEyMWJjZTJmMWNiYTVhNzQwZGM=');
    $url="http://api.youku.com/api_rest?method=video.getvideofile&pid=XOA==&ctime=$time&auth=$auth&videoid=$key";
    //直接读取.
    $file = file_get_contents($url,LOCK_EX);
    preg_match_all('/url="(http.*)"/isU',$file,$url);
    return $url[1];
    }
      

  2.   

    YouKu的 视频地址跟YOUTUBE的很相似啊,youtube的也差不多。
      

  3.   

    9L,为什么我这儿提示说auth fail 呢!